GOLD16.INF Driver File Contents (688w9x.exe)

[Version]
Signature="$CHICAGO$"
Class=MEDIA
provider=%TERRA%

[ControlFlags]
ExcludeFromSelect=VIRTUAL\ESS6881-DMAEmulation
ExcludeFromSelect=VIRTUAL\ESS1681-DMAEmulation
ExcludeFromSelect=VIRTUAL\ESS1781-DMAEmulation

[ClassInstall]
AddReg=Class.AddReg

[Class.AddReg]
HKR,,,,%MediaClassName%
HKR,,Icon,,"-1"
HKR,,Installer,,mmci.dll

[Manufacturer]
%ESSMfgName%=ESS

[ESS]
%*ESS6881.DeviceDesc%=ESS6881_Device,*ESS6881
%*ESS1681.DeviceDesc%=ESS1681_Device,*ESS1681

[PreCopySection]
HKR,,NoSetupUI,,1

;---------------------------------------------------------------;

[ESS6881_Device]
LogConfig=ESS6881.LC1,ESS6881.LC2,ESS6881.LC3
DelFiles=ESS.DelList
CopyFiles=ESS6881.CopyList
DelReg=WAVE.DelReg
AddReg=WAVE.AddReg,MIXER.AddReg,ESS6881.AddReg,ESSCheck.AddReg,GPO.AddReg,ES938.AddReg
UpdateInis=ESS.UpdateInis
UpdateIniFields=Drivers.fields

[ESS6881_Device.FactDef]
ConfigPriority=NORMAL
IOConfig=220-22F
IOConfig=388-38B
IRQConfig=7
DMAConfig=1

[ESS1681_Device]
LogConfig=ESS1681.LC1,ESS1681.LC2,ESS1681.LC3,ESS1681.LC4,ESS1681.LC5,ESS1681.LC6,ESS1681.LC7
DelFiles=ESS.DelList,ESS.DelList1
CopyFiles=ESS1681.CopyList
DelReg=WAVE.DelReg
AddReg=WAVE.AddReg,MIXER.AddReg,ESS1681.AddReg,ESSCheck.AddReg,GPO.AddReg,ES938.AddReg
UpdateInis=ESS.UpdateInis
UpdateIniFields=Drivers.fields

[ESS1681_Device.FactDef]
ConfigPriority=NORMAL
IOConfig=220-22F
IOConfig=388-38B
IOConfig=330-331
IRQConfig=7
DMAConfig=1

;---------------------------------------------------------------;

[ESS.UpdateInis]
system.ini,386Enh,"device=vaudrv.386"
system.ini,386Enh,"device=es488win.386"
system.ini,386Enh,"device=es688win.386"
system.ini,386Enh,"device=es888win.386"
system.ini,386Enh,"device=es1488wn.386"
system.ini,386Enh,"device=es1688wn.386"
system.ini,386Enh,"device=es1788wn.386"
system.ini,386Enh,"device=es1868wn.386"
system.ini,386Enh,"device=es1888wn.386"
system.ini,386Enh,"device=esx88win.386"
system.ini,386Enh,"device=vsbpd.386"
system.ini,386Enh,"device=vadlibd.386"
system.ini,386Enh,"device=vadlib.386"
system.ini,386Enh,"device=vsbd.386"
system.ini,drivers,"wave*=auddrive.drv",,1
system.ini,drivers,"midi*=auddrive.drv",,1
system.ini,drivers,"aux*=auddrive.drv",,1
system.ini,drivers,"mixer*=auddrive.drv",,1
system.ini,drivers,"midi*=audmpu.drv",,1
system.ini,drivers,"midi*=audmpio.drv",,1
system.ini,drivers,"wave*=es488win.drv",,1
system.ini,drivers,"midi*=es488win.drv",,1
system.ini,drivers,"aux*=es488win.drv",,1
system.ini,drivers,"mixer*=es488win.drv",,1
system.ini,drivers,"wave*=es688win.drv",,1
system.ini,drivers,"midi*=es688win.drv",,1
system.ini,drivers,"aux*=es688win.drv",,1
system.ini,drivers,"mixer*=es688win.drv",,1
system.ini,drivers,"wave*=es888win.drv",,1
system.ini,drivers,"midi*=es888win.drv",,1
system.ini,drivers,"aux*=es888win.drv",,1
system.ini,drivers,"mixer*=es888win.drv",,1
system.ini,drivers,"wave*=es1488wn.drv",,1
system.ini,drivers,"midi*=es1488wn.drv",,1
system.ini,drivers,"aux*=es1488wn.drv",,1
system.ini,drivers,"mixer*=es1488wn.drv",,1
system.ini,drivers,"wave*=es1688wn.drv",,1
system.ini,drivers,"midi*=es1688wn.drv",,1
system.ini,drivers,"aux*=es1688wn.drv",,1
system.ini,drivers,"mixer*=es1688wn.drv",,1
system.ini,drivers,"wave*=es1788wn.drv",,1
system.ini,drivers,"midi*=es1788wn.drv",,1
system.ini,drivers,"aux*=es1788wn.drv",,1
system.ini,drivers,"mixer*=es1788wn.drv",,1
system.ini,drivers,"wave*=es1868wn.drv",,1
system.ini,drivers,"midi*=es1868wn.drv",,1
system.ini,drivers,"aux*=es1868wn.drv",,1
system.ini,drivers,"mixer*=es1868wn.drv",,1
system.ini,drivers,"wave*=es1888wn.drv",,1
system.ini,drivers,"midi*=es1888wn.drv",,1
system.ini,drivers,"aux*=es1888wn.drv",,1
system.ini,drivers,"mixer*=es1888wn.drv",,1
win.ini,windows,load,essdaemn.exe,,

;---------------------------------------------------------------;

[ESS6881.LC1]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=388-38B
IRQConfig=5,7,9,10
DMAConfig=0,1,3

[ESS6881.LC2]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IRQConfig=5,7,9,10
DMAConfig=0,1,3

[ESS6881.LC3]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=388-38B
IRQConfig=5,7,9,10

[ESS1681.LC1]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=388-38B
IOConfig=300-301,310-311,320-321,330-331
IRQConfig=5,7,9,10
DMAConfig=0,1,3

[ESS1681.LC2]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=388-38B
IOConfig=300-301,310-311,320-321,330-331
IRQConfig=5,7,9,10
IRQConfig=5,7,9,10,11
DMAConfig=0,1,3

[ESS1681.LC3]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=388-38B
IRQConfig=5,7,9,10
DMAConfig=0,1,3

[ESS1681.LC4]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=300-301,310-311,320-321,330-331
IRQConfig=5,7,9,10
DMAConfig=0,1,3

[ESS1681.LC5]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=300-301,310-311,320-321,330-331
IRQConfig=5,7,9,10
IRQConfig=5,7,9,10,11
DMAConfig=0,1,3

[ESS1681.LC6]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IRQConfig=5,7,9,10
DMAConfig=0,1,3

[ESS1681.LC7]
ConfigPriority=NORMAL
IOConfig=220-22F,230-23F,240-24F,250-25F
IOConfig=388-38B
IOConfig=300-301,310-311,320-321,330-331
IRQConfig=5,7,9,10

;---------------------------------------------------------------;

[*ESS6881.Det]
AddReg=PreCopySection

[*ESS1681.Det]
AddReg=PreCopySection

;---------------------------------------------------------------;

[ESS6881.CopyList]
es688.vxd,,
es688.drv,,
essfm.drv,,
essmport.drv,,

[ESS1681.CopyList]
es1688.vxd,,
es1688.drv,,
esfm.drv,,
essmpu.drv,,

;---------------------------------------------------------------;

[ESS.DelList]
vaudrv.386,,,1
es488win.386,,,1
es688win.386,,,1
es888win.386,,,1
es1488wn.386,,,1
es1688wn.386,,,1
es1788wn.386,,,1
es1868wn.386,,,1
es1888wn.386,,,1
auddrive.drv,,,1
es488win.drv,,,1
es688win.drv,,,1
es888win.drv,,,1
es1488wn.drv,,,1
es1688wn.drv,,,1
es1788wn.drv,,,1
es1868wn.drv,,,1
es1888wn.drv,,,1
audmpio.drv,,,1
audmpu.drv,,,1
auddrive.hlp,,,1
audmpu.hlp,,,1
nullwave.drv,,,1

[ESS.DelList1]
essfm.drv,,,1

;---------------------------------------------------------------;

[ESSCheck.AddReg]
HKLM,%KEY_FIL%\PostInstall,UpdateIniFields,,"UpdateIniFields=fl.UpdateIniFields"
HKLM,%KEY_FIL%\fl.UpdateIniFields,,,"1"
HKLM,%KEY_FIL%\fl.UpdateIniFields,msmixmgr,,"system.ini,boot,drivers,msmixmgr.dll"

[Drivers.fields]
system.ini,boot,drivers,msmixmgr.dll
system.ini,boot,drivers,mmmixer.dll

;---------------------------------------------------------------;

[ESS6881.AddReg]
HKR,,Driver,,es688.vxd
HKR,Drivers\wave\es688.drv,Description,,%*ESS6881.DeviceDesc%
HKR,Drivers\wave\es688.drv,Driver,,es688.drv
HKR,Drivers\midi\essfm.drv,Description,,%V_INTERNAL%
HKR,Drivers\midi\essfm.drv,Driver,,essfm.drv
HKR,Drivers\midi\essmport.drv,Description,,%V_EXTERNAL%
HKR,Drivers\midi\essmport.drv,External,1,01,00,00,00
HKR,Drivers\midi\essmport.drv,Driver,,essmport.drv
HKR,Drivers\mixer\es688.drv,Description,,%*ESS6881.DeviceDesc%
HKR,Drivers\mixer\es688.drv,Driver,,es688.drv
HKR,Drivers\aux\es688.drv,Description,,%*ESS6881.DeviceDesc%
HKR,Drivers\aux\es688.drv,Driver,,es688.drv
HKR,Drivers,SubClasses,,"wave,midi,aux,mixer"
HKR,"Config\IRQ Selections",Default,,"9,5,7,10"
HKR,"Config\DMA Selections",Default,,"0,1,3"

[ESS1681.AddReg]
HKR,,Driver,,es1688.vxd
HKR,Drivers\wave\es1688.drv,Description,,%*ESS1681.DeviceDesc%
HKR,Drivers\wave\es1688.drv,Driver,,es1688.drv
HKR,Drivers\midi\esfm.drv,Description,,%V_ESFM%
HKR,Drivers\midi\esfm.drv,Driver,,esfm.drv
HKR,Drivers\midi\essmpu.drv,Description,,%V_EXTERNAL%
HKR,Drivers\midi\essmpu.drv,External,1,01,00,00,00
HKR,Drivers\midi\essmpu.drv,Driver,,essmpu.drv
HKR,Drivers\mixer\es1688.drv,Description,,%*ESS1681.DeviceDesc%
HKR,Drivers\mixer\es1688.drv,Driver,,es1688.drv
HKR,Drivers\aux\es1688.drv,Description,,%*ESS1681.DeviceDesc%
HKR,Drivers\aux\es1688.drv,Driver,,es1688.drv
HKR,Drivers,SubClasses,,"wave,midi,aux,mixer"
HKR,"Config\Port Selections",Default,,"220,230,240,250"
HKR,"Config\IRQ Selections",Default,,"9,5,7,10"
HKR,"Config\DMA Selections",Default,,"0,1,3"
HKR,"Config\MPU401 Port Selections",Default,,"300,310,320,330"
HKR,"Config\MPU401 IRQ Selections",Default,,"9,5,7,10,11"

[ESS6881_DMA_Emul_Device.AddReg]
HKR,,DeviceDriver,,es688.vxd
HKR,,DevLoader,,*CONFIGMG

[ESS1681_DMA_Emul_Device.AddReg]
HKR,,DeviceDriver,,es1688.vxd
HKR,,DevLoader,,*CONFIGMG

[MIXER.AddReg]
HKLM,Software\Microsoft\Windows\CurrentVersion\Run,SystemTray,,"SysTray.Exe"
HKLM,%KEY_IOC%\Vol,,,

[WAVE.AddReg]
HKR,,DevLoader,,mmdevldr.vxd
HKR,Drivers,MIGRATED,,0
HKLM,%KEY_IOC%\acm,,,
HKLM,%KEY_IOC%\Rec,,,
HKLM,%KEY_IOC%\MPlay,,,

[WAVE.DelReg]
HKR,Drivers\midi
HKR,Drivers\wave
HKR,Drivers\mixer
HKR,Drivers\aux

;---------------------------------------------------------------;

[DisksNames]
1=      "",     ,

[SourceDisksNames]
1="Install Disk 1",,

[Files]
[SourceDisksFiles]
es688.drv=      1,      ,
es688.vxd=      1,      ,
es1688.drv=     1,      ,
es1688.vxd=     1,      ,
esfm.drv=       1,      ,
essfm.drv=      1,      ,
essmport.drv=   1,      ,
essmpu.drv=     1,      ,

[DestinationDirs]
DefaultDestDir = 11

;---------------------------------------------------------------;

[Strings]
;Non-localized strings
KEY_WARNVER="SYSTEM\CurrentControlSet\Control\SessionManager\WarnVerDLLs"
KEY_CHKVER="SYSTEM\CurrentControlSet\Control\SessionManager\CheckVerDLLs"
KEY_FIL="SYSTEM\CurrentControlSet\Control\MediaResources\FilterList"
KEY_UI="SYSTEM\CurrentControlSet\Control\MediaResources\FilterList\fl.UpdateInis"
KEY_IOC="SYSTEM\CurrentControlSet\Control\MediaResources\InstallOptionalComponents"

;Localized strings
TERRA="TerraTec Profimedia"
ESSMfgName="TerraTec Electronic GmbH"
*ESS6881.DeviceDesc="Gold 16 ohne MPU-401 Interface (688)"
*ESS1681.DeviceDesc="Gold 16 mit MPU-401 Interface (1688)"

MediaClassName="Sound, video and game controllers"
V_INTERNAL="Interne OPL2/OPL3 FM Synthese"
V_EXTERNAL="Externer MIDI-Anschluß o. Wavetable"
V_ESFM="Interne ESS FM Synthese"

;---------------------------------------------------------------;

[GPO.AddReg]
; Deleting the semicolon before a "HKR,..." line below "enables" that line.
; Enabling "GPO0 Default" forces GPO0 pin high.
; Enabling "GPO0 Show" makes mixer app control of GPO0 possible.
; Enabling "GPO0 LongLabel" defines the GPO0 long label in the mixer app.
; Enabling "GPO0 Label" defines the GPO0 short label in the mixer app.
; Enabling "GPO1 Default" forces GPO1 pin low.
; Enabling "GPO1 Show" makes mixer app control of GPO1 possible.
; Enabling "GPO1 LongLabel" defines the GPO1 long label in the mixer app.
; Enabling "GPO1 Label" defines the GPO1 short label in the mixer app.
; Note: A long/short label may contain up to 63/15 characters, respectively.
;
;HKR,"Config\GPO Selections","GPO0 Default",01,01,00,00,00
;HKR,"Config\GPO Selections","GPO0 Show",01,01,00,00,00
;HKR,"Config\GPO Selections","GPO0 LongLabel",,"General Purpose Output 0"
;HKR,"Config\GPO Selections","GPO0 Label",,"GPO0"
;HKR,"Config\GPO Selections","GPO1 Default",01,00,00,00,00
;HKR,"Config\GPO Selections","GPO1 Show",01,01,00,00,00
;HKR,"Config\GPO Selections","GPO1 LongLabel",,"General Purpose Output 1"
;HKR,"Config\GPO Selections","GPO1 Label",,"GPO1"

[ES938.AddReg]
; Deleting the semicolon before a "HKR,..." line below "enables" that line.
; Enabling "Do Not Want ES938" makes mixer app control of treble, bass and spatializer possible.
; Enabling "Treble" forces the initial treble level to 0x00007FFF.
; Enabling "Bass" forces the initial bass level to 0x00007FFF.
; Enabling "Spatializer" forces the initial spatializer level to 0x0000FFFF.
; Note: Levels range from 0x00000000 (min, represented as 00,00,00,00) to
; 0x0000FFFF (max, represented as FF,FF,00,00).
;
;HKR,"Config","Do Not Want ES938",01,00,00,00,00
;HKR,"Config","Treble",01,FF,7F,00,00
;HKR,"Config","Bass",01,FF,7F,00,00
;HKR,"Config","Spatializer",01,FF,FF,01,00
Download Driver Pack

How To Update Drivers Manually

After your driver has been downloaded, follow these simple steps to install it.

  • Expand the archive file (if the download file is in zip or rar format).

  • If the expanded file has an .exe extension, double click it and follow the installation instructions.

  • Otherwise, open Device Manager by right-clicking the Start menu and selecting Device Manager.

  • Find the device and model you want to update in the device list.

  • Double-click on it to open the Properties dialog box.

  • From the Properties dialog box, select the Driver tab.

  • Click the Update Driver button, then follow the instructions.

Very important: You must reboot your system to ensure that any driver updates have taken effect.

For more help, visit our Driver Support section for step-by-step videos on how to install drivers for every file type.

server: ftp, load: 1.84